For Amtrak passengers, Amtrak Taxi Connector Voucher between Vancouver Station and Bus Terminal (Downtown) is available. The voucher is redeemable for one-way travel between C-TRAN's 7th Street Transit Center and the Vancouver Amtrak Station. Please ask Amtrak Staff for more detail. |

1. An Amtrak Talgo Cascades train comes off the BNSF Bridge over the Columbia River and prepares to make a brief stop at the Vancouver, WA, depot before continuing north to Seattle. |
|
|
|
2. An Amtrak Talgo Cascades train makes a brief stop at the Vancouver, WA, depot, in this photo looking northward, before continuing on to Seattle. |
|
|
|
3. Looking from the south part of the station platform, the BNSF railroad bridge over the Columbia River is open for river traffic. The bridge must be realigned to allow trains to cross again. |
